    Verdict

    KAHFRE gets the vote in the opener just ahead of Whipperway. Although Gary Moore's entry carries top weight due to the conditions, the trip looks ideal and at least he completed his round in a much tougher Listed race at Wetherby in which Whipperway was a faller. The selection has raced two other times over the jumps; winning at Plumpton and just losing out at Huntingdon. He is narrowly picked in preference to Sheena West's option who won at Fontwell prior to coming down last time out. It would probably take a pair of rose-tinted spectacles to see beyond these two but Jonjo O'Neill has a knack for getting the winners and Miss Miracle has put in two solid enough runs over the timber to throw her in to contention if the others fail to perform.
